Transaction 58406cbe503c77fbe89750afccc4000a281935a4b879b78078850514e8597508
1 Input
2 Outputs
- 58406cbe503c77fbe89750afccc4000a281935a4b879b78078850514e8597508:0
- 58406cbe503c77fbe89750afccc4000a281935a4b879b78078850514e8597508:1
value 8000
address 1P3UBoSABwiQhZ8HQwgAMc7DnA5a21gUqk
value 7108208794
address 1J55S7ywYaoPiKHejCYtBrwA6zgHsvPu3f